What to do with your unwanted boat?
What type of Unwanted boat do you have?
There are all kinds of unwanted boats around the UK and Europe, and indeed the rest of the world. Whether it’s a boat you’ve inherited, a boat you’ve loved and looked after for years but can no longer afford or want. Or it’s a boat that is at the end of its life and you need to get rid of it.
When it comes to getting rid of them, your options depend on the current condition of the boat and your situation. We have outlined the options we can provide to help you dispose of your unwanted boat below:
Option 1: Trade it to BuyAnyBoat.net
If you are looking for a quick sale and the boat is still in a fair condition, you can try offering your unwanted boat to BuyAnyBoat.net for a trade sale.
Simply fill in their form, making sure to supply some recent pictures and they will get back to you within a few days with either an offer to buy your boat, or to say it’s not one they are looking to buy.
Option 2: List and Sell the boat yourself
If the boat isn’t something BuyAnyBoat.net are interested in, or the boat is in a project condition, you can try and list the boat yourself.
There are many places available online where you can sell a boat, from sites like eBay and Gumtree to various classifieds sites. We offer a couple of free options you can use:
